Numer of letters
Answer
River in the Asian part of Russia, in the West Siberian Lowland.
2
Ob
The city was founded by Idris I in the 8th century CE. In 807, the next ruler, Idris II, established the first capital of Morocco here.
3
Fez
One of the Great Lakes of North America.
4
Erie
The city is located on the Shatt Al Arab waterway near the Persian Gulf. It is the second largest city in Iraq.
5
Basra
Tunisian island in the Mediterranean Sea. It has been connected with the African continent by a dyke since Roman times.
6
Djerba
Canada's largest territory.
7
Nunavut
Hint
Numer of letters
Answer
The Norwegian province in the Arctic Ocean, encompassing the archipelago, the largest island of which is Spitsbergen.
8
Svalbard
British Overseas Territory on the southern coast of the Iberian Peninsula in Southern Europe.
9
Gibraltar
Characteristically shaped rock formation located in Norway on the edge of the Hardangervidda plateau. The name means troll tongue.
10
Trolltunga
A city in Russia, the capital of Primorsky Krai. The end point of the Trans-Siberian Railway.
11
Vladivostok
The capital of the archipelago from the question - 8 letters. It has over 1.8 thousand inhabitants.
12
Longyearbyen
Eight thousand meters high, the highest point in India, the second highest peak in the Himalayas, the third highest peak in the Earth.
13
Kangchenjunga
